Machinists Union Will Not Back Down at Boeing South Carolina

F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E 

WASHINGTON, Sept. 9, 2019 – This unprincipled decision from the NLRB’s anti-worker majority board will not stop our organizing campaign at Boeing South Carolina. We will not relent or back down. We are staying in North Charleston. This decision is irresponsible and reckless. American workers are under attack from those who value corporations over working families. We stand with the Flight Line and all workers at Boeing South Carolina and justice will prevail when their voices are recognized.

The IAM represents more than 35,000 Boeing employees across the United States. The International Association of Machinists and Aerospace Workers (IAM) represents 600,000 active and retired members in the North American aerospace, defense, airline, manufacturing, transportation, woodworking, the federal sector and other industries. Machinists Union members work at Boeing, Lockheed-Martin, General Electric, United Airlines, Harley-Davidson and more. Visit goIAM.org for more information.
